Ira Newton Abernathy was born in 1913 in Bushnell, Kimball County, Nebraska, USA, the child of Lemuel Peter Abernathy And Anna Lucretia Castle. Ira Newton Abernathy married Bernice Haygood, Margaret Lorraine Davis. Ira Newton Abernathy passed away in 2004 in Albany, Linn County, Oregon, USA.
